Dell PowerEdge R330 Owner's Manual

Installing a cabled hard drive into a hard drive carrier

Prerequisites

CAUTION: Many repairs may only be done by a certified service technician. You should only perform troubleshooting and simple repairs as authorized in your product documentation, or as directed by the online or telephone service and support team. Damage due to servicing that is not authorized by Dell is not covered by your warranty. Read and follow the safety instructions that are shipped with your product.

  1. Ensure that you follow the Safety instructions.
  2. Follow the procedure listed in Before working inside your system.
  3. Remove the hard drive carrier.
  4. Keep the Phillips #2 screwdriver ready.

Steps

  1. Insert the hard drive into the hard drive carrier with the connector end of the hard drive toward the back of the hard drive carrier.
  2. Align the screw holes on the hard drive with the screw holes on the hard drive carrier.
    When aligned correctly, the back of the hard drive is flush with the back of the hard drive carrier.
  3. Install the screws to secure the hard drive to the hard drive carrier.
    Figure 1. Installing a cabled hard drive to a cabled hard drive carrier
    This figure shows installing a cabled hard drive to a cabled hard drive carrier.
    1. screw (4)
    2. cabled hard drive
    3. cabled hard drive carrier

Next steps

  1. Install the cabled hard drive carrier.
  2. Follow the procedure listed in After working inside your system.
